Transaction 5390383de2f51c2a84f0b29fda52910d711583c1ce0bc52b77ffb3f3cf55cc74
1 Input
1 Outputs
- 5390383de2f51c2a84f0b29fda52910d711583c1ce0bc52b77ffb3f3cf55cc74:0
value 9353268
address 14SEqkQ4BrcJmcdTM4R7mKkRU3h1PoTB75